## DNS Flake Mitigation — Norrbridge Resolver

If lookups to the internal pricing host fail intermittently, flush the edge cache and force re-resolution via the Resolvette admin API. Check TTLs before and after. Escalate if failure rate exceeds 2% over ten minutes. The admin API authenticates with the key below.

gateway credential: kto3_qfe

- [ ] Brief the new starter on after-hours server room access at Fennick House. Outside 08:00–18:00, the east stairwell door stays locked and the server room on Level B1 requires a secondary pass. Reception should confirm the starter's line manager has approved after-hours access in the Kestrelgate system before issuing anything. Once approval shows as active, hand over the lanyard and walk them to the B1 door. The current pass code is below.

staff pass of kawip-hawef = bdg-QLP-2

## Runbook: Gaugepile Sidecar — Release Checklist

Heads up: the sidecar ships with every app pod, so a bad config fans out fast. Before cutting a release, confirm the flush interval hasn't drifted from what the Tallyhouse aggregator expects, or you'll see sawtooth gaps in dashboards. Rollbacks are cheap — just repin the image tag. Canary one node pool first, watch for ten minutes, then proceed. The values to verify against are these.

config for bagep-yafof:
quenath:
  pin: 8584
  metrics_host: metrics.quenath.tolvaqsys.internal
  tenant: pelath
  seal: seal_ed102645

## Further Reading

The Driftnet sweeper finds and removes orphaned resources left behind by failed provisioning runs in the Halvero platform. Support should know that sweeps run nightly, deletions are soft for seven days, and customers can request restores within that window. Restore procedures, exclusion rules, and the escalation path are described on the internal page below.

dashboard of bafof-hafog = https://confluence.lumiclabs.internal/display/browse/display/6a09a20a